How Water Damage Repair Actually Works

We know that water damage can be a stressful and overwhelming experience. That’s why we’re committed to making the process as smooth and hassle-free as possible. From the initial assessment to the final repair, our team will guide you every step of the way. We’ll work with you to develop a personalized plan that meets your unique needs and budget.

Step 1: Assessment and Inspection

Our technicians will arrive within 60 minutes of your call to assess the damage.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ect any hidden moisture or structural damage. Our goal is to identify the source of the problem and develop a plan to fix it.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Next, we’ll use powerful pumps and vacuums to extract as much water as possible from your home. This is a critical step in pre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old and mildew.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water is removed, we’ll use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ify your home. This may involve setting up fans, dehumidifiers, and other equipment to speed up the drying process.

Step 4: Repair and Reconstruction

Finally, we’ll repair or replace any damaged materials, including drywall, flooring, and cabinets. Our goal is to return your home to its pre-damage condition, with minimal disruption to your daily life.

Warning Signs You Need Water Damage Repair

Water damage can be sneaky, but there are often warning signs that show a problem. Don’t ignore these signs – they can save you money and prevent bigger issues down the line.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Is your home smelling musty or mildewy? This could be a sign of hidden moisture or water damage. Don’t ignore the smell – it’s a warning sign that you need to address the issue before it gets worse.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Is your flooring warped or buckled? This could be a sign of water damage or moisture buildup. Don’t ignore the problem – it can spread to other areas of your home and cause further damage.

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ls

Do you see water stains on your ceiling or walls? This could be a sign of a roof leak or water damage. Don’t ignore the stains – they can show a more serious problem that needs to be addressed.

Visible Signs of Mold or Mildew

Do you see visible signs of mold or mildew in your home? This could be a sign of water damage or moisture buildup. Don’t ignore the problem – it can spread to other areas of your home and cause further damage.

Water Damage Repair v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ak under the sink Yes No You can easily fix the leak with a wrench and some plumbing tape.
Flooded basement from a burst pipe No Yes This is a serious issue that needs professional equipment and expertise to fix.
Water damage to a small area of drywall Yes No You can easily repair the drywall yourself with some spackling and paint.
Water damage to a large area of your home No Yes This is a complex issue that needs professional equipment and expertise to fix.
Hidden moisture or water damage No Yes This is a serious issue that needs professional equipment and expertise to detect and fix.
Water damage to your appliances or plumbing No Yes This is a serious issue that needs professional equipment and expertise to fix.

Water Damage Repair Cost In St. Louis Park, MN

The cost of water damage repair can vary widely depending on the severity and size of the affected area. We’ll work with you to develop a personalized plan that meets your unique needs and budget. Our estimates are free and based on an on-site assessment.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 The size of the affected area and the amount of water present.
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 The size of the affected area and the amount of equipment needed.
Repair and Reconstruction $2,000 – $10,000 The size of the affected area and the materials needed for repair.
Hidden Moisture Detection $500 – $2,000 The size of the affected area and the complexity of the issue.
Water Damage to Appliances or Plumbing $1,000 – $5,000 The type and extent of the damage.
Water Damage to Drywall or Flooring $500 – $2,000 The size of the affected area and the materials needed for repair.

Can I Prevent Water Damage?

Yes, there are steps you can take to prevent water damage. Regularly inspect your home for signs of moisture or water damage, and address any issues quickly. You can also install a water sensor or alarm system to detect leaks and alert you to potential problems.

What Happens If I Ignore Water Damage?

Ignoring water damage can lead to further damage, mold and mildew growth, and even structural issues. Don’t ignore the problem – address it quickly to avoid costly repairs and potential health risks.
